SN74LVT574DW Overview
It is embeded in 20-SOIC (0.295, 7.50mm Width) case. It is included in the package Tube. It is configured with Tri-State, Non-Invertedas an output. There is a trigger configured with Positive Edge. The electronic part is mounted in the way of Surface Mount. A voltage of 2.7V~3.6Vis required for its operation. A temperature of -40°C~85°C TAis considered to be the operating temperature. The type of this D latch is D-Type. JK flip flop is a part of the 74LVTseries of FPGAs. In order for it to function properly, its output frequency should not exceed 150MHz. D latch consists of 1 elements. It consumes 190μA of quiescent There are 20 terminations, which are the practice of ending a transmission line with a device that matches the characteristic impedance of the line. You can search similar parts based on 74LVT574. The power supply voltage is 3.3V. This JK flip flop has a 4pFfarad input capacitance. A device of this type belongs to the family of LVT. A part of the electronic system is mounted in the way of Surface Mount. This board is designed with 20pins on it. This device's clock edge trigger type is Positive Edge. This part is included in Bus Driver/Transceiver. An electronic part with 8bits has been designed. For normal operation, the supply voltage (Vsup) should be kept above 2.7V. Its flexibility is enhanced by 8 circuits. The D flip flop has no ports embedded. For high efficiency, the supply voltage should be kept at 3.3V. It offers maximum design flexibility with its output current of 64mA. It operates with 3 output lines.
